/Linux-v6.1/drivers/gpu/drm/amd/display/dc/dcn302/ |
D | dcn302_hwseq.c | 47 uint32_t power_gate = power_on ? 0 : 1; in dcn302_dpp_pg_control() local 58 DOMAIN1_POWER_GATE, power_gate); in dcn302_dpp_pg_control() 66 DOMAIN3_POWER_GATE, power_gate); in dcn302_dpp_pg_control() 74 DOMAIN5_POWER_GATE, power_gate); in dcn302_dpp_pg_control() 82 DOMAIN7_POWER_GATE, power_gate); in dcn302_dpp_pg_control() 90 DOMAIN9_POWER_GATE, power_gate); in dcn302_dpp_pg_control() 104 uint32_t power_gate = power_on ? 0 : 1; in dcn302_hubp_pg_control() local 115 DOMAIN0_POWER_GATE, power_gate); in dcn302_hubp_pg_control() 123 DOMAIN2_POWER_GATE, power_gate); in dcn302_hubp_pg_control() 131 DOMAIN4_POWER_GATE, power_gate); in dcn302_hubp_pg_control() [all …]
|
/Linux-v6.1/drivers/gpu/drm/amd/display/dc/dcn31/ |
D | dcn31_hwseq.c | 304 uint32_t power_gate = power_on ? 0 : 1; in dcn31_dsc_pg_control() local 324 DOMAIN_POWER_GATE, power_gate); in dcn31_dsc_pg_control() 332 DOMAIN_POWER_GATE, power_gate); in dcn31_dsc_pg_control() 340 DOMAIN_POWER_GATE, power_gate); in dcn31_dsc_pg_control() 457 uint32_t power_gate = power_on ? 0 : 1; in dcn31_hubp_pg_control() local 471 REG_SET(DOMAIN0_PG_CONFIG, 0, DOMAIN_POWER_GATE, power_gate); in dcn31_hubp_pg_control() 475 REG_SET(DOMAIN1_PG_CONFIG, 0, DOMAIN_POWER_GATE, power_gate); in dcn31_hubp_pg_control() 479 REG_SET(DOMAIN2_PG_CONFIG, 0, DOMAIN_POWER_GATE, power_gate); in dcn31_hubp_pg_control() 483 REG_SET(DOMAIN3_PG_CONFIG, 0, DOMAIN_POWER_GATE, power_gate); in dcn31_hubp_pg_control()
|
/Linux-v6.1/drivers/gpu/drm/amd/display/dc/dcn314/ |
D | dcn314_hwseq.c | 244 uint32_t power_gate = power_on ? 0 : 1; in dcn314_dsc_pg_control() local 264 DOMAIN_POWER_GATE, power_gate); in dcn314_dsc_pg_control() 272 DOMAIN_POWER_GATE, power_gate); in dcn314_dsc_pg_control() 280 DOMAIN_POWER_GATE, power_gate); in dcn314_dsc_pg_control() 288 DOMAIN_POWER_GATE, power_gate); in dcn314_dsc_pg_control()
|
/Linux-v6.1/drivers/gpu/drm/amd/display/dc/dcn32/ |
D | dcn32_hwseq.c | 75 uint32_t power_gate = power_on ? 0 : 1; in dcn32_dsc_pg_control() local 89 DOMAIN_POWER_GATE, power_gate); in dcn32_dsc_pg_control() 97 DOMAIN_POWER_GATE, power_gate); in dcn32_dsc_pg_control() 105 DOMAIN_POWER_GATE, power_gate); in dcn32_dsc_pg_control() 113 DOMAIN_POWER_GATE, power_gate); in dcn32_dsc_pg_control() 153 uint32_t power_gate = power_on ? 0 : 1; in dcn32_hubp_pg_control() local 164 REG_SET(DOMAIN0_PG_CONFIG, 0, DOMAIN_POWER_GATE, power_gate); in dcn32_hubp_pg_control() 168 REG_SET(DOMAIN1_PG_CONFIG, 0, DOMAIN_POWER_GATE, power_gate); in dcn32_hubp_pg_control() 172 REG_SET(DOMAIN2_PG_CONFIG, 0, DOMAIN_POWER_GATE, power_gate); in dcn32_hubp_pg_control() 176 REG_SET(DOMAIN3_PG_CONFIG, 0, DOMAIN_POWER_GATE, power_gate); in dcn32_hubp_pg_control()
|
/Linux-v6.1/drivers/gpu/drm/amd/pm/swsmu/ |
D | amdgpu_smu.c | 202 struct smu_power_gate *power_gate = &smu_power->power_gate; in smu_dpm_set_vcn_enable() local 208 if (atomic_read(&power_gate->vcn_gated) ^ enable) in smu_dpm_set_vcn_enable() 213 atomic_set(&power_gate->vcn_gated, !enable); in smu_dpm_set_vcn_enable() 222 struct smu_power_gate *power_gate = &smu_power->power_gate; in smu_dpm_set_jpeg_enable() local 228 if (atomic_read(&power_gate->jpeg_gated) ^ enable) in smu_dpm_set_jpeg_enable() 233 atomic_set(&power_gate->jpeg_gated, !enable); in smu_dpm_set_jpeg_enable() 648 struct smu_power_gate *power_gate = &smu_power->power_gate; in smu_set_default_dpm_table() local 655 vcn_gate = atomic_read(&power_gate->vcn_gated); in smu_set_default_dpm_table() 656 jpeg_gate = atomic_read(&power_gate->jpeg_gated); in smu_set_default_dpm_table() 1045 atomic_set(&smu->smu_power.power_gate.vcn_gated, 1); in smu_sw_init() [all …]
|
/Linux-v6.1/drivers/gpu/drm/amd/display/dc/dcn20/ |
D | dcn20_hwseq.c | 348 uint32_t power_gate = power_on ? 0 : 1; in dcn20_dsc_pg_control() local 365 DOMAIN16_POWER_GATE, power_gate); in dcn20_dsc_pg_control() 373 DOMAIN17_POWER_GATE, power_gate); in dcn20_dsc_pg_control() 381 DOMAIN18_POWER_GATE, power_gate); in dcn20_dsc_pg_control() 389 DOMAIN19_POWER_GATE, power_gate); in dcn20_dsc_pg_control() 397 DOMAIN20_POWER_GATE, power_gate); in dcn20_dsc_pg_control() 405 DOMAIN21_POWER_GATE, power_gate); in dcn20_dsc_pg_control() 425 uint32_t power_gate = power_on ? 0 : 1; in dcn20_dpp_pg_control() local 436 DOMAIN1_POWER_GATE, power_gate); in dcn20_dpp_pg_control() 444 DOMAIN3_POWER_GATE, power_gate); in dcn20_dpp_pg_control() [all …]
|
/Linux-v6.1/drivers/gpu/drm/amd/display/dc/dcn10/ |
D | dcn10_hw_sequencer.c | 621 uint32_t power_gate = power_on ? 0 : 1; in dcn10_dpp_pg_control() local 632 DOMAIN1_POWER_GATE, power_gate); in dcn10_dpp_pg_control() 640 DOMAIN3_POWER_GATE, power_gate); in dcn10_dpp_pg_control() 648 DOMAIN5_POWER_GATE, power_gate); in dcn10_dpp_pg_control() 656 DOMAIN7_POWER_GATE, power_gate); in dcn10_dpp_pg_control() 682 uint32_t power_gate = power_on ? 0 : 1; in dcn10_hubp_pg_control() local 693 DOMAIN0_POWER_GATE, power_gate); in dcn10_hubp_pg_control() 701 DOMAIN2_POWER_GATE, power_gate); in dcn10_hubp_pg_control() 709 DOMAIN4_POWER_GATE, power_gate); in dcn10_hubp_pg_control() 717 DOMAIN6_POWER_GATE, power_gate); in dcn10_hubp_pg_control()
|
/Linux-v6.1/drivers/gpu/drm/amd/pm/swsmu/inc/ |
D | amdgpu_smu.h | 388 struct smu_power_gate power_gate; member
|